Lifeguard
Pay Rate:
$20.00
Seasonal Lifeguards, under direct supervision of the Aquatics Manager, and general supervision of Assistant Aquatic Managers, performs routine patrol work at assigned aquatic facilities, looking after the safety and welfare of swimmers and patrons. This is important work consisting primarily of routine patrol tasks performed under direct supervision. Employees must be constantly alert to assist swimmers when they are in difficulty and to enforce safety rules. Work requires exercise of sound judgment in emergencies, as well as:
• Stands guard and patrols at pools keeping swimmers and patrons safe and going to their aid when they are in difficulty.
• In emergencies, applies resuscitation techniques and otherwise renders first aid.
• Instructs beginner to advance swimming classes as assigned.
• Keeps locker rooms and poolside areas free of glass and other debris.
• Maintains order and enforces safety rules.
• Performs other routine duties such as maintaining and repairing equipment.
• Maintains recreation management software for all swim related activities and events.
• Assists front counter staff with helping customers, taking registrations, memberships, and answering questions related to the facilities and programs.
• Tracks and collects data including, but not limited to, daily participation, general ages of participants, type of activity performed, and location of pool area most utilized.
• Performs related duties as required.

Chief Information Technology Officer
Pay Rate:
$121,640 - $174,100
This position functions in a key executive management role, reporting to the Commissioner of Administrative Services, providing leadership in the strategic planning, development, acquisition, implementation, and operational initiatives in all areas of information and communication technologies in a constantly changing environment.
The work is performed under the general direction of the Commissioner of Administrative Services with broad latitude given for the exercise of independent professional and technical judgment.
The incumbent sets overall City IT policies to meet organizational goals; sets priorities for systems development, implements information technology security controls and cybersecurity protocols within the City, coordinates departmental user needs in an integrated approach to maximize the efficient and effective application of technological and staffing resources.
The Chief Information Technology Officer oversees the purchasing or contracting of all hardware, software and peripheral equipment; develops, negotiates and monitors all contracts for related services.
Administrative supervision is exercised over all IT Office staff.
Does related work as required.
